According to a survey taken at an amusement park about visitors' favorite rides, 22 of the 50 visitors surveyed like the bumper

cars the best. what percent of people chose the bumper cars as their favorite ride
A.44%
B.22%
C.0.44%
D.11%

Total number of visitors who visited the amusement park = 50

Number of people who chose bumper car ride as favorite = 22

We have to find the percent of people chose the bumper cars as their favorite ride.

So, the percent of people chose the bumper cars as their favorite ride

= (Number of people who liked bumper cars \div Total number of visitors) \times 100

= \frac{22}{50} \times 100

= 44%

So, 44% of the visitors chose bumper cars as their favorite ride.

Find the area of the shaded region
nexus9112 [7]

Answer:

40

Step-by-step explanation:

area of shaded region = area of whole figure - area of non shaded region

area of whole figure: The whole figure is a rectangle

The area of a rectangle can simply be calculated by multiplying the width by the length

The given width is 10ft and the given length is 8ft

Hence area of whole figure = 10 * 8 = 80ft²

Area of non shaded region: the non shaded region also creates a rectangle

Like stated previously the area of a rectangle can simply be calculated by multiplying the width by the length

The given width is 5ft and the given length is 8ft

Hence, area of non shaded region = 5 * 8 = 40ft²

Finally we can find the area of the shaded region.

We can easily do this my subtracting the area of the nonshaded region from the area of the whole figure

If we have identified that the area of the whole figure is 80 and the area of the non shaded region is 40

Then, area of shaded region = 80 - 40 = 40ft²
